Here we see a carefully constructed image designed to convey status and authority. The subject’s complexion appears rosy, suggesting health and vitality, while the slight smile conveys an air of amiable confidence rather than overt arrogance. His hair is styled in the elaborate fashion characteristic of the late 18th century, meticulously arranged with powdered curls framing his face.
The clothing contributes significantly to the overall impression. A rich red coat dominates the composition, its deep color signifying power and nobility. Over this, a ceremonial cloak or mantle is draped, adorned with intricate embroidery and numerous medals and orders. These decorations are not merely ornamental; they serve as visual markers of rank and service, suggesting a life dedicated to public duty and recognition. The details of the insignia – the crosses, stars, and ribbons – are rendered with precision, highlighting their significance.
The artist’s technique is characterized by smooth brushwork and subtle gradations of tone, creating a sense of realism while maintaining an idealized representation of the subject. Theres a deliberate softening of features that contributes to a dignified portrayal. The dark background serves to isolate the figure, drawing attention solely to his personage and reinforcing his elevated position.
Subtly, the portrait suggests themes of lineage, responsibility, and societal standing. It is likely intended as a record of an individual’s place within a hierarchical structure, communicating not only personal identity but also belonging to a specific social order. The overall effect is one of restrained grandeur – a visual statement designed to project respectability and authority.
